Among the most prevalent issues for Windows users is performance deterioration. Signs consist of sluggish boot times, applications that lag, and a basic sluggishness when browsing the os.
Software Application Crashes and Errors
Applications regularly become unstable, resulting in crashes that interrupt user experience. Users may experience error messages, application freezes, or unanticipated reboots.
Network Connectivity Issues
Lots of users experience problems connecting to the web, such as Wi-Fi disconnections, restricted connection mistakes, and sluggish speeds. These issues can occur from a variety of sources including hardware failures, configuration errors, and network blockage.

When standard solutions fail, advanced methods might be needed:
Use the Task Manager: Users can access Task Manager (Ctrl + Shift + Esc) to identify and end jobs that are causing high CPU or memory use.Carry Out a System Restore: If issues started after a recent change, reverting the system to a previous state through System Restore can help remove the problems.Examine Device Manager for Driver Issues: Outdated or corrupted chauffeurs can cause software application crashes and hardware malfunctions. Users need to guarantee that motorists are updated and correctly configured.Troubleshooting Network Issues

How do I know if my Windows is updated?
Users can look for updates by navigating to Settings > > Update & & Security > > Windows Update. The system will notify you if updates are available.

What is a system bring back point?
A system restore point is a picture of your computer's system files and settings at a particular point in time. It can be utilized to revert to a previous state if issues emerge after changes are made.
